Creation of a source text
Creation of a new text file: File/New
Saving the file: File/Save As …
Source-text writing:
;Program name: test.asm
#INCLUDE <P16F883.INC> ;DEFINITION FILE
NOP
MOVLW .25
MOVWF 0x20 ; 0x20 = first free position in the data memory
INCF 0x20
GOTO $-1
END ;END OF THE SOURCE-TEXT WRITING

Source text editor/ Project - summary
Source text editor:Only source-text writingIndicates syntactic errorsDistinguishes in color between individual columns of the writing
Saving: File/Save As… (only a text file is saved!)
Project:Starting, stopping, step-by-step operation and animation of the programDisplay of the program memory, display of the EEPROM memoryDisplay of SFRs and user registersWork with BreakpointsStopwatch – measuring the duration of a specific part of the programProgramming of a microcontroller
Saving: Project/Save Project As…
